    Hotel room keys typically utilize RFID technology or magnetic strips to grant access to rooms. These keys may store various types of information that can impact guest privacy.

    Common data includes room number, check-in and check-out dates, and sometimes personal identification details. Understanding this information is crucial for safeguarding your data while staying at hotels.

    Hotel keys can store different types of data depending on the technology used. Knowing what information is on your key can help you assess privacy risks. Here are some common data types:

    • Room Number: Essential for granting access to your specific room.

    • Check-in and Check-out Dates: Used to manage room availability and billing.

    • Guest Name: Sometimes encoded for identification purposes.

    • Payment Information: In some cases, keys may link to payment methods.

    Data privacy is a significant concern with hotel room keys. Unauthorized access to this information can lead to identity theft or other privacy violations. Guests should be aware of the following risks:

    • Data Breaches: Hotels may experience breaches that expose guest data.

    • Unauthorized Access: If someone obtains your key, they can access your room and personal belongings.

    • Tracking: Some systems may track guest movements within the hotel.

    Understanding the technology behind hotel keys can help you assess their security. Most hotels use either RFID or magnetic strip technology. Here’s a comparison of both:

    Technology Type Security Level Ease of Use Cost to Hotel
    RFID High Very Easy Moderate
    Magnetic Strip Moderate Easy Low

    RFID keys are more secure than magnetic strip keys due to encryption and anti-cloning features. However, they may be more expensive for hotels to implement.

    Losing your hotel key can pose serious privacy risks. Immediate action is necessary to mitigate these risks. Follow these steps:

    • Notify Hotel Staff: Report the loss to the front desk as soon as possible.

    • Change Room: Request a room change if you feel your safety is compromised.

    • Monitor Accounts: Keep an eye on your financial accounts for any unusual activity.
